RN732ATTD2000D50 Equivalent & Substitute Parts

Part Overview

The RN732ATTD2000D50 is a 200 Ohm ±0.5% thin film chip resistor manufactured by KOA Speer Electronics, Inc., rated at 0.1W (1/10W) in 0805 (2012 Metric) package format. This component features moisture-resistant construction with a temperature coefficient of ±50ppm/°C and operates across -55°C to 155°C. The part is currently listed as obsolete, necessitating identification of equivalent and substitute components for ongoing design requirements and production continuity.

Substitute Part Grouping Explanation

Substitution of the RN732ATTD2000D50 is determined by the following critical parameters:

Primary Compatibility Criteria:

  • Resistance value: 200 Ohms (exact match required)
  • Package format: 0805 (2012 Metric) (exact match required)
  • Composition: Thin Film (exact match required)
  • Tolerance: ±0.5% or tighter (±0.1% acceptable as upgrade)
  • Temperature coefficient: ±50ppm/°C or better (lower values acceptable)
  • Operating temperature range: Must support -55°C ~ 155°C minimum
  • Moisture Sensitivity Level: 1 (Unlimited) or equivalent

Power Rating Consideration: The original part is rated at 0.1W (1/10W). Substitute parts with equal or higher power ratings (0.125W, 0.25W) are functionally compatible, as higher power ratings provide additional thermal margin without affecting electrical performance at the original operating point.

Substitution Categories:

Direct Substitutes (Same Tolerance ±0.5%):

  • RN73R2ATTD2000D50 (KOA Speer, 0.125W, Active status)
  • RNCF0805DKC200R (Stackpole, 0.25W, Active status)
  • RNCF0805DTC200R (Stackpole, 0.25W, Active status)
  • MCU08050D2000DP500 (Vishay, 0.125W, Active status)
  • RG2012N-201-D-T5 (Susumu, 0.125W, Active status)

Upgrade Substitutes (Tighter Tolerance ±0.1%):

  • CPF0805B200RE1 (TE Connectivity, 0.1W, ±0.1% tolerance, ±25ppm/°C)
  • ERA-6AEB201V (Panasonic, 0.125W, ±0.1% tolerance, ±25ppm/°C, AEC-Q200)
  • MCU08050D2000BP100 (Vishay, 0.125W, ±0.1% tolerance, ±25ppm/°C)
  • MCU08050D2000BP500 (Vishay, 0.125W, ±0.1% tolerance, ±25ppm/°C)
  • RG2012N-201-B-T5 (Susumu, 0.125W, ±0.1% tolerance, ±10ppm/°C, AEC-Q200)

Engineering Selection Recommendations

For Direct Replacement (Matching ±0.5% Tolerance):

RN73R2ATTD2000D50 is the primary direct substitute, offering identical electrical specifications with active product status and AEC-Q200 automotive qualification. This part maintains the same tolerance and temperature coefficient while providing increased power rating (0.125W vs. 0.1W) and moisture resistance.

RNCF0805DKC200R and RNCF0805DTC200R (Stackpole) provide equivalent performance with higher power ratings (0.25W) and AEC-Q200 certification. These parts are suitable for applications requiring automotive-grade reliability.

MCU08050D2000DP500 (Vishay) offers ±0.5% tolerance matching with anti-sulfur construction and full temperature range support (-55°C ~ 155°C). This part is recommended for environments with corrosive atmospheres.

RG2012N-201-D-T5 (Susumu) provides ±0.5% tolerance with superior temperature coefficient (±10ppm/°C vs. ±50ppm/°C) and AEC-Q200 certification, suitable for precision applications requiring automotive qualification.

For Upgraded Performance (±0.1% Tolerance):

ERA-6AEB201V (Panasonic) is recommended for applications requiring tighter tolerance control. This part combines ±0.1% tolerance, improved temperature coefficient (±25ppm/°C), AEC-Q200 certification, and full temperature range support.

RG2012N-201-B-T5 (Susumu) offers the most stringent specifications with ±0.1% tolerance, ±10ppm/°C temperature coefficient, and AEC-Q200 automotive qualification. This part is optimal for precision measurement and signal conditioning circuits.

CPF0805B200RE1 (TE Connectivity) provides ±0.1% tolerance with matching 0.1W power rating and ±25ppm/°C temperature coefficient. This part is suitable for applications where power rating must remain unchanged.

For Temperature-Limited Applications:

MCU08050D2000BP100 and MCU08050D2000BP500 (Vishay) are suitable only for applications with maximum operating temperature of 125°C. These parts feature anti-sulfur construction and ±0.1% tolerance but do not support the full -55°C ~ 155°C range of the original part.

Frequently Asked Questions (FAQ)

Q: Can I use a substitute part with higher power rating than the original 0.1W specification?

A: Yes. Substitute parts rated at 0.125W or 0.25W are functionally compatible. Higher power ratings provide additional thermal margin and do not affect electrical performance when operating at the original power level. The component will operate safely within its rated power envelope.

Q: What is the difference between direct substitutes and upgrade substitutes?

A: Direct substitutes maintain the original ±0.5% tolerance specification. Upgrade substitutes feature tighter ±0.1% tolerance, lower temperature coefficients, and often include automotive AEC-Q200 certification. Upgrade substitutes provide improved accuracy and stability but may have different pricing and lead times.

Q: Are all substitute parts compatible with the 0805 package footprint?

A: Yes. All listed substitute parts use the 0805 (2012 Metric) package format with identical land pattern dimensions (0.079" L x 0.049" W / 2.00mm x 1.25mm). Physical compatibility is confirmed across all substitutes.

Q: Which substitute should I select for automotive applications?

A: For automotive applications, select parts with AEC-Q200 certification: RN73R2ATTD2000D50, RNCF0805DKC200R, RNCF0805DTC200R, ERA-6AEB201V, RG2012N-201-B-T5, or RG2012N-201-D-T5. These parts meet automotive reliability and qualification standards.

Q: Does the temperature coefficient difference affect circuit performance?

A: Temperature coefficient affects resistance stability across temperature variations. The original part specifies ±50ppm/°C. Substitute parts with lower coefficients (±25ppm/°C or ±10ppm/°C) provide improved stability. For applications sensitive to resistance drift, select substitutes with lower temperature coefficients.

Q: Can I use MCU08050D2000BP100 if my circuit operates above 125°C?

A: No. MCU08050D2000BP100 and MCU08050D2000BP500 are rated only to 125°C maximum. The original RN732ATTD2000D50 supports -55°C ~ 155°C. For full temperature range compatibility, select alternatives rated to 155°C: RN73R2ATTD2000D50, RNCF0805DKC200R, RNCF0805DTC200R, CPF0805B200RE1, ERA-6AEB201V, RG2012N-201-B-T5, or RG2012N-201-D-T5.

Q: What does ROHS3 Compliant status mean?

A: ROHS3 Compliant indicates the component meets Restriction of Hazardous Substances Directive 3 requirements, restricting lead, cadmium, mercury, and other hazardous materials. All listed parts maintain ROHS3 compliance.

Q: What is Moisture Sensitivity Level (MSL) 1?

A: MSL 1 indicates unlimited shelf life without moisture control requirements. All listed substitute parts maintain MSL 1 rating, requiring no special storage or handling procedures.
